Host a home spa party and give your guests our bath
fizzies as party favors. You can also make them as part of the party and
use them in pedicures at the party. Let your guests choose their own
flower, oil and coloring combinations. Great for holiday parties - make
our fizzies as gifts! Dried flowers add a wonderful scent and look pretty
floating around the tub. As for scents, we love peppermint and citrus
scents.
Pedicure fizzie ingredients:
- 1 Pound Citric Acid
- 3 Pounds Baking Soda
- Essential or Fragrant Oils
- Food Coloring Oil
- Spray Bottle for Water
- Desired molds
- Basic Pedicure
Products
Combine acid and baking soda and mix thoroughly. Add a
few drops of food coloring and oil and again, mix well. Sprinkle dried
flowers if desired. Mix again. Lightly spray with water and keep mixing
and spraying (very lightly) until the mixture starts to stick together.
Press firmly into molds and let dry. Dry time depends on moisture in
mixture - between 1-8 hours. Punch out of molds and wrap for gifting!
1. Remove old polish with cotton or gauze (preferred).
2. File toe nails with a heavy
duty nail file straight across to prevent hangnails.
3. Fill pedicure tubs with warm water once guest has
feet immersed, drop in bath fizzie.
4. Guests should soak feet for 5- 10 minutes.
5. Exfoliate soles with pedicure
pumice stone. Rinse in tub.
6. Proceed with pedicure
(start with #4) and polish.
